Honda Insight Forum banner
new england
1-1 of 1 Results
  1. Hybrid Socials and Events
    Hey everyone I am just returning to the States after a long absence and would like to support a potential Insight meetup this summer. I have land and a cabin in Maine and am living around Boston. Please answer the poll below to show your interest (or not).
1-1 of 1 Results